Self-Supervised Prompt Optimization (2025.findings-emnlp)

Challenge: Existing prompt optimization methods rely heavily on external references such as ground truth or by humans, limiting their applicability in real-world scenarios where such data is unavailable or costly to obtain.
Approach: They propose a cost-efficient framework that discovers effective prompts for both closed and open-ended tasks without external reference.
Outcome: The proposed framework outperforms state-of-the-art prompt optimization methods with significantly lower costs and fewer samples.
Learning Named Entity Tagger using Domain-Specific Dictionary (D18-1)

Challenge: Existing methods to build reliable named entity recognition systems require large amounts of manually-labeled training data.
Approach: They propose a revised fuzzy CRF layer to handle tokens with multiple possible labels to address noisy distant supervision.
Outcome: The proposed model can handle tokens with multiple possible labels under the traditional framework and improves on the existing model with a new Tie or Break scheme.
Hierarchical Multi-label Text Classification with Horizontal and Vertical Category Correlations (2021.emnlp-main)

Challenge: Existing approaches to hierarchical multi-label text classification ignore vertical category correlations or exploit dependencies across levels without considering horizontal correlations .
Approach: They propose a hierarchical multi-label text classification framework that considers both vertical and horizontal category correlations.
Outcome: The proposed framework improves on real-world HMTC datasets with significant improvements over baselines.
